Native Shores
Originally released in 1943. Native Shores is a war/drama film. directed by Volodymyr Braun. At just 58 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Faina Ranevskaya, Daniil Sagal, and Anatoliy Nikitin
Synopsis
Three soldiers make their way into a city occupied by the Nazis.
